Introduction -- Being physical -- Nurture -- Being creative -- Lifelong learning -- Truth -- Accepting imperfection -- Connecting with others.
"Learn how to feed your body and your mind with the soothing craft of baking bread"-- Provided by publisher.
When life gets challenging, simple pleasures and timeless traditions can help us manage. Beaumont guides you through the art of breadmaking, with insight into the benefits of this ancient craft. She explore breadmaking as a way of making positive changes to our mental and physical well-being. The result is a delightful meditation on the intrinsic power of baking bread. -- adapted from back cover
